Choosing infrastructure shouldn't start with technology, but with scale, risk and budget. For one company a VPS with backup is best, for another Kubernetes, and for a third a ready SaaS or a managed self-hosted app.
IaaS
What you buy
servers, network, backup, administration
When it makes sense
simple apps, more control, lower cost
When it doesn't
when the team wants a deployment platform
PaaS
What you buy
an application environment with services
When it makes sense
SaaS, API, worker, e-commerce, microservices
When it doesn't
when the app is very simple
SaaS / self-hosted
What you buy
a specific app under management
When it makes sense
GitLab, Sentry, Zabbix, OpenSearch, company tools
When it doesn't
when the license or SaaS cost is unfavourable
